Rooney’s son scores four goals for Man Utd's youth team

The 11-year-old is following the footsteps of his father at Old Trafford, making exceptional progress in the Red Devils’ academy ranks.

Manchester United’s youth team were defeated 5-4 by Liverpool, in a night that saw

Kai Rooney

score all four of his side’s goals. Being the son of Man Utd’s all-time top scorer, Kai has a long road ahead of him at Manchester United. However, he has already shown impressive development in his game, evident in his recent performances for the Red Devils.

Rooney junior signed a youth contract with Manchester United in December 2020. Wayne Rooney published an Instagram post at the time, expressing his happiness about the move.

"Proud day. Kai signing for Man Utd. Keep up the hard work son."

the Man Utd legend wrote.

Kai is playing alongside Cristiano Ronaldo’s son, Cristiano Jr, at Manchester United's youth team. Cristiano Jr was under a youth contract at Juventus’ academy, but he moved to Man United upon his dad’s return to the club.
